How to Use This Calculator
  1. Enter Room Length and Room Width in feet — measure the usable floor area, not walls.
  2. Choose the Table Type: Round (60"/8 seats), Rectangular (8 ft/8 seats), or Cocktail Highboy (4 seats).
  3. Set the Aisle Width in feet — at least 4 ft between tables for comfortable guest movement.
  4. Review Max Guests and Max Tables to verify the room can hold your planned attendance.
  5. Check Dance Floor Area and Remaining Free Space to confirm you have room for entertainment and circulation.
